The site of Alejandro Bulgheroni Estate was first planted by to grapes by Jim and Nina Talcott in 1975. Under their ownership a charming stone winery was built to vinify the property’s grapes. After its acquisition Alejandro Bulgheroni began an extensive renovation and enhancement project to pgrade the old stone winery, plant new vineyard blocks, transform the tasting salon and re-invision the future of the property. The winery renovations provided upgraded infrastructure to new equipment dedicated solely to the vinification of Alejandro Bulgheroni Estate wines. The new tasting salon is available exclusively to members of the Estate’s allocation list and offers educational tastings.
Alejandro Bulgheroni Lithology Napa Valley Cabernet Sauvignon 2016 is a blend of declassified lots from around Napa Valley, composed of 91% Cabernet Sauvignon and 9% Cabernet Franc aged for 22 months in 59% new French oak, the 2016 Lithology Cabernet Sauvignon Napa Valley is deep garnet-purple in color and opens with fragrant cassis, ripe plums and black cherries notes with touches of lilacs, dark chocolate and underbrush. Full-bodied, rich and with fantastic concentration, it has a seductive, velvety texture and a long berry and mineral-laced finish.
